[About the creature (Dimorphodon)]
- Classification: Reptilia/Ichthyosauria/Ichthyosauridae
- Size: Total length 3 meters
- Period of habitat: Late Triassic to Early Jurassic
- A type of ichthyosaur that looked similar to modern dolphins.
- Its head was smoothly connected to its streamlined body, and it is believed that it could have used its paddle-like legs and large, well-developed tail fin to move through the water at high speeds.
- Its eyes were so large that it was thought it could spot its predators, large carnivorous marine reptiles, from long distances.
- Its long jaws were equipped with numerous sharp teeth, and coprolites suggest that it preyed on fish, squid, and other marine creatures.
